For my C5Z. I would also like this can to have no more than -4* overlap as I live in CA and want this thing to pass emissions as I'm tired of taking cams out of this car lol I'm wanting a nice broad power band that will carry to the 6,800 rev limiter. I'm thinking EPS/LXL or LXL/LXL, something quieter as this is a driver and the cam will be in the car long term whether the blower is on the car or not.
-317's w/ patriot duals
-LS9 HG's
-1 3/4" LT's, off road X, Ti cat back
-A&A V2 Si (not looking to go over 12lbs)
-91 pump gas w/ Meth
Lets hear em!

I kept the IVC the same as your 230/230 111lsa+2 cam
Not sure what exhaust you'll be running whether it's LT headers, shorty headers, or gm manifolds, so that's why two choices.
I'd go with the 226 exh. for LT headers, and the 230 exh. for gm manifolds or shorty headers.
218(lxl)/226(lxl) 115lsa +0, -8*OL, IVC 44 .
218(lxl)/230(lxl) 115lsa +0, -6*OL, IVC 44 .
